Bishop Steps Down as ANU Chancellor, Citing Concerns Over Government Overreach

Date:

The Chancellor of the Australian National University Julie Bishop speaks at Parliament House in Canberra, Australia, on Oct. 10, 2025. Hilary Wardhaugh/Getty ImagesFormer Foreign Minister Julie Bishop has resigned as chancellor of the Australian National University (ANU) following months of turmoil surrounding financial restructuring, workplace culture allegations and the departure of vice-chancellor Genevieve Bell.Bishop’s resignation takes effect immediately, months before her term was due to end in December. She has held the position since January 2020.
